The end of your minimum term is what many people associate with being "due" an upgrade, when this is actually just "entitled" to upgrade if you so wish.
There is no rule that says you must upgrade, if you are happy to continue as you are - that is perfectly fine too.

We do recommend processing upgrades whilst in the UK using the EE network.
Should you wish to do this when you return from the states your current plan will just continue to roll out of contract till your home.

If your just on a Sim Only Plan then nothing will really change, from an Accounts point of view you will just go a Contract Plan to a 30 Day Rolling Monthly Plan.
You can just leave it as it is or if you wish yo change to a different Sim Plan do it when you come back.
